The Enduring Legacy of the Nike Air Force 1 Silhouette
Before we dive into the neon green variations, it’s crucial to understand the foundation upon which they’re built: the Nike Air Force 1 silhouette itself. The shoe's enduring appeal lies in its simple yet sophisticated design. The clean lines, the perforated toe box, the padded collar, and the iconic swoosh – each element contributes to a timeless aesthetic that transcends fleeting trends. The initial success of the Air Force 1 was driven by its on-court performance, featuring Nike's innovative Air cushioning technology for superior comfort and impact protection. However, its transition to the streets in the 1990s solidified its status as a cultural cornerstone.
